# Feature-Oriented Event-Driven Application Skeleton
|
||||
|
||||
A Python-based asynchronous application framework designed for building scalable, event-driven systems using a feature-oriented architecture. This skeleton provides a solid foundation for building complex applications with clear separation of concerns, dependency injection, and event-driven communication patterns.
|
||||
|
||||
## Overview
|
||||
|
||||
This project implements a feature-oriented architecture where functionality is organized into independent, self-contained features that communicate through an event-driven model. Each feature is responsible for its own initialization, configuration, and bootstrap logic, making the system highly modular and testable.
|
||||
|
||||
### Key Concepts
|
||||
|
||||
- **Feature-Oriented**: Application logic is divided into independent features, each with its own provider for configuration and lifecycle management
|
||||
- **Event-Driven**: Features communicate asynchronously through an event emitter
|
||||
- **Async-First**: Built on Python's `asyncio` for high-performance concurrent operations
|
||||
- **Dependency Injection**: Uses the `punq` container for loose coupling and testability
|
||||
- **Kernel-Centric**: Core infrastructure (application lifecycle, messaging, events) lives in the `kernel` namespace
|
||||
|
||||

## Architecture Patterns
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Feature Provider Pattern
|
||||
|
||||
Each feature must implement a **Feature Provider** - a class that inherits from `Provider` (and optionally `Registrar` mixin):
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
from typing import override
|
||||
from kernel.feature.provider import Provider
|
||||
from kernel.event.registrar import Registrar
|
||||
from shared.event.type import Type as EventType
|
||||
|
||||
class MyFeature(Provider, Registrar):
|
||||
@override
|
||||
def register(self) -> None:
|
||||
"""
|
||||
Called during DI container initialization.
|
||||
- Register classes in the container
|
||||
- Load configurations
|
||||
- Set up initial state
|
||||
"""
|
||||
self._container.register(MyService)
|
||||
|
||||
@override
|
||||
def bootstrap(self) -> None:
|
||||
"""
|
||||
Called after all features are registered.
|
||||
- Start background tasks
|
||||
- Attach event listeners
|
||||
- Initialize runtime state
|
||||
"""
|
||||
self.add_event_listener(EventType.MESSAGE_RECEIVED, MyEventListener)
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Event Listener Pattern
|
||||
|
||||
Create an event listener that inherits from `Listener[T]`:
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
from kernel.event.listener import Listener
|
||||
from shared.event.type import Type as EventType
|
||||
|
||||
class MyEventListener(Listener[MyEventType]):
|
||||
async def handle(self, event: str, payload: MyEventType) -> None:
|
||||
# Process the event
|
||||
pass
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Attach it in your feature's `bootstrap()` method using the `Registrar` mixin.
|
||||
|
||||
### 3. Dependency Injection
|
||||
|
||||
All dependencies are resolved through the `punq` Container:
|
||||
|
||||
```python
|
||||
from punq import Container
|
||||
|
||||
class MyService:
|
||||
def __init__(self, container: Container) -> None:
|
||||
self._container = container
|
||||
|
||||
def do_something(self) -> None:
|
||||
dependency = self._container.resolve(SomeDependency)
|
||||
```
|

## Key Design Principles
|
||||
|
||||
1. **Kernel is Core**: Infrastructure lives in `kernel/`, never import from `feature/` into `kernel/`
|
||||
2. **Shared for Common Code**: Cross-cutting concerns and shared implementations belong in `shared/`
|
||||
3. **Features are Independent**: Features should not depend on other features directly
|
||||
4. **DI Over Coupling**: Use the DI container to manage dependencies
|
||||
5. **Async-First**: Embrace async/await throughout the codebase
|
||||
6. **Events for Communication**: Features communicate through events, not direct calls
|
||||
7. **Provider Pattern**: Each feature must implement the Provider pattern with `register()` and `bootstrap()` methods
|
||||
|
||||
## Performance Considerations
|
||||
|
||||
- **Graceful Shutdown**: Application responds to SIGTERM and SIGINT signals
|
||||
- **Resource Cleanup**: Set `stop_grace_period: 3s` in Docker Compose for clean shutdown
|
||||
- **Connection Pooling**: RabbitMQ and Redis connections are pooled for efficiency
|
||||
- **Event-Driven**: Non-blocking event handling allows processing many messages concurrently
|
